Notes:

  1. “Online enquiries on applications” are suitable for initial applications, renewal and extension to family members, submitted on or after 1 January 2007.
  2. Only the applicant, and his/her family members or his/her proxy are entitled to the online enquiry on the applications.
  3. Full record of the applicant’s identification will not be shown for privacy purposes.
  4. According to the relevant laws, we will put on hold the time for approval, whilst waiting for the comments of other government departments on the application, or whilst waiting for the applicant to submit any outstanding documents.
  5. To facilitate an orderly renewal of the applications, please pre-arrange with us the date for the renewal no later than 180 days before the expiry of the temporary residency.
  6. If 180 days has lapsed after the expiry of your temporary residency and you have not approached us to complete the procedures for the renewal of the temporary residency, then “that residency will be deemed invalid and the cumulated time of residence required to be eligible for the permanent residency will be discontinued.”
  7. After the applicant has obtained the temporary residency and the Macao non-permanent Identity Card, and maintained that status for seven consecutive years, as well as abided by the relevant laws and regulations of Macao, the Macao Immigration Department will certify the actual period the temporary residency for 7 years on the relevant documents. Then the applicant may approach the Macao Identification Bureau to apply for a Macao Permanent Resident Identity Card. If the applicant has not resided for “seven consecutive years” in Macao after obtaining the temporary residency, he/she may not be granted the permanent Identity Card seven years after the approval of the temporary residency.
  8. If the applicant has maintained the temporary residency for 7 consecutive years (including the situation when an extension to the applicant’s family members is being requested, it was foreseeable that the main applicant would soon complete 7 years of residency in Macao), then the application to extend the residency to his/her family members shall not be made through our Institute, while the previous application records and reasons will be kept valid until his/her family members under the scheme will complete given for 7 consecutive years of temporary residency.
